to sb's face
If you say something unpleasant to someone's face, you say it to them directly, when you are with them:
If you've got something to say, say it to my face.

to face
to (someone's) face
if you say something unpleasant to someone's face, you say it to them directly, without worrying whether they will be upset or angry.
Everyone refers to him as 'Junior' but no one would dare call him that to his face.

to (your) face
directly to you.
I already knew the answer, but I wanted him to say it to my face, even if it embarrassed him.

to one's face
adv. phr. Directly to you; in your presence.
I told him to his face that I didn't like the idea.
I called him a coward to his face.
Compare: IN ONE'S FACE.
Antonym: BEHIND ONE'S BACK.
